Curve 65472i1

65472 = 26 · 3 · 11 · 31



Data for elliptic curve 65472i1

Field Data Notes
Atkin-Lehner 2+ 3+ 11- 31+ Signs for the Atkin-Lehner involutions
Class 65472i Isogeny class
Conductor 65472 Conductor
∏ cp 4 Product of Tamagawa factors cp
deg 165888 Modular degree for the optimal curve
Δ 1513632567744 = 26 · 38 · 112 · 313 Discriminant
Eigenvalues 2+ 3+ -2 -2 11- -4  8  2 Hecke eigenvalues for primes up to 20
Equation [0,-1,0,-39424,-2999246] [a1,a2,a3,a4,a6]
j 105885578215194688/23650508871 j-invariant
L 0.33881630130476 L(r)(E,1)/r!
Ω 0.33881629274253 Real period
R 1 Regulator
r 0 Rank of the group of rational points
S 1 (Analytic) order of Ш
t 2 Number of elements in the torsion subgroup
Twists 65472v1 32736c2 Quadratic twists by: -4 8
